DEBRIEFING:
Every member of the group is given a paper and a pen and is invited to write down 3 verbs, 2 nouns and 1 adjective regarding their emotions and possible self-discoveries during the exercise. Then they share them with the rest of the group. Questions to support a discussion: How was it to have to depend on the others? Was it easy/difficult for you to lose control? Why? How was it being responsible to protect the people in the centre? VARIATIONS
If the group is experienced and cohesive enough, it could be suggested as a second step, the person in the centre to step on a chair, and the circle of the subgroup turns to 2 aligned rows with the arms knitted. Then the person on the chair could be invited to fall into the formed collective “hug” of the other people.
